php使用oci8連接oracle數據庫的方法
php使用oci8連接oracle數據庫的方法"/>php中,使用OCI8擴展可以連接oracle數據庫,相比于其他數據庫,OCI8的是oracle官方提供的擴展,更加穩定和可靠。
下面就來看看如何使用OCI8來連接oracle數據庫。
1. 安裝OCI8擴展
yum install php-oci8
安裝OCI8擴展,如果是CentOS系統,可以使用yum命令進行安裝。
2. 查看是否安裝成功
php -m | grep oci8
安裝完成后,使用php -m | grep oci8命令查看是否已經安裝OCI8擴展。
3. 連接oracle數據庫
$conn = oci_connect('username', 'password', 'ip/db_name'); if (!conn) { $error = oci_error(); throw new Exception($error['message']); }
使用oci_connect函數連接oracle數據庫,第一個參數為用戶名,第二個參數為密碼,第三個參數為ip和數據庫名稱。
4. 執行sql語句
$sql = "SELECT * FROM table_name WHERE column_id = :id"; $stmt = oci_parse($conn, $sql); oci_bind_by_name($stmt, ':id', $id); oci_execute($stmt);
使用oci_parse函數解析sql語句,并使用oci_bind_by_name函數綁定sql語句中的參數,最后使用oci_execute函數執行sql語句。
5. 獲取查詢結果
while (($result = oci_fetch_assoc($stmt)) != false) { var_dump($result); }
使用oci_fetch_assoc函數獲取查詢結果,并使用while循環遍歷結果集。
以上就是使用OCI8連接oracle數據庫的全部流程。使用OCI8擴展來連接oracle數據庫可以快速、穩定地將數據從php應用中存儲到oracle數據庫中,進而為應用提供更好的數據保護和存儲服務。
上一篇php pdo 永久